Ethan Fogelstrom Delivers Best Performance of Season
Ethan Fogelstrom produced his most outstanding game to date while leading Entiat to the win on Friday. Fogelstrom rushed for 132 yards and three touchdowns on only 13 carries, and also threw for 262 yards and three touchdowns while completing 87.5% of his passes.
Fogelstrom and Entiat will welcome Bridgeport at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. The last time Fogelstrom took on the Mustangs, he rushed for 34 yards and two touchdowns. Can he match (or beat) that performance?

Entiat Wins Sixth-Straight Thanks to Arthuro Delgado
Arthuro Delgado's big game helped extend Entiat's winning streak to six on Friday. Delgado turned in nothing short of a gem, rushing for 68 yards on only seven carries, while also catching a touchdown.
Delgado is probably looking forward to his next game, a road matchup against Bridgeport on Friday. Back in October of 2023 (the last time Delgado saw the Mustangs), he rushed for 47 yards and two touchdowns.

Valadez-Robinson Came Up Big in Entiat's 58-30 Win
Entiat picked up their sixth consecutive win on Friday thanks in part to Monico Valadez-Robinson. Valadez-Robinson turned in nothing short of a gem, picking up 204 receiving yards and a touchdown. He showed off some serious burst, lighting up the secondary with a catch for 58 yards.
Unfortunately for Oroville, this isn't the first big game they've seen from Valadez-Robinson. When Valadez-Robinson last faced the Hornets back in September of 2023, he picked up 163 receiving yards and three touchdowns.

Lopez Posts Huge Game in 54-6 Victory
Winning always takes teamwork, but on Thursday Jairo Lopez stepped things up a notch to give Soap Lake the 'W'. Lopez was unstoppable, throwing for 85 yards and four touchdowns while completing 75% of his passes. He didn't just play on offense: he also picked up a sack and made six total tackles (3.0 for loss).
Lopez and Soap Lake will take on Oroville at 5:00 p.m. on Friday. The Eagles got just the result they wanted when they last faced the Hornets, probably because Lopez had a solid game then too: he threw for 235 yards and two touchdowns while completing 83.3% of his passes. Can he match (or beat) that performance?
